Deliberate Disinformation

During the Gaza War, there have been at least two instances of investments made to influence public perception of the conflict in the Middle East. In June 2025, Google reportedly signed a contract for $45M to support Israeli propaganda, including displaying ads on YouTube and Google claiming that “There is food in Gaza,” a contradiction of the reports of major UN and international bodies that have declared a famine in the enclave.  In the same year, Project Esther, an initiative of the conservative Heritage Foundation, was billed as a strategy to battle antisemitism on college campuses. However, it was developed without the involvement of Jewish groups, and seeks to target left leaning groups by smearing them as terrorists or as members of a “Hamas network.” This “terrorist” labeling in turn enables a variety of other legal actions that would not be acceptable to the majority of Americans.
